Specifications include, but are not limited to: The Red River Street Realignment Project consists of realigning Red River Street from approximately its intersection with 18th Street to approximately its intersection with 32nd Street. This realignment will align it generally along the route of the existing Robert Dedman Drive, and will vacate the existing Red River ROW from approximately its intersection with MLK Jr. Blvd. and its intersection with Clyde Littlefield Drive. Included in the project is design and construction of new paving, curb and gutter, street lighting, pedestrian lighting, landscaping and other amenities. This project is being undertaken in support of and related to the design and construction of a new arena to host University Men’s and Women’s Basketball games consisting of an approximately 15,000 – seat, state-of-the-art, first class public venue, community event center and basketball arena consistent with other recently completed arenas for NCAA “Power Five” college basketball programs.
